> Im not big LDAP expert so I hope this is bug and not my misunderstanding of something LDAP specific feature or something similar.
> We have problems with the way DS is working with case of some parts in DN strings. We have some groups in ldap which have DN that look like this:
> cn=somegroup,ou=groups,DC=EXT,DC=COM
> we need DC in uppercase because of some application and Websphere Application Server rights checking and so these groups are stored with DC in uppercase in LDAP.
> Problem with Apache Directory studio is that with such groups it's workjng like it is stored like:
> cn=somegroup,ou=groups,dc=EXT,dc=COM
> So dc here is converted to lowercase.
> DS is displaying it like this, also when I copy DN to clipboard, export ldif etc, Im still getting dc in lowecase. 
> Even also when Im creating new group and I use existing group as template (and this existing group has DC in uppecase) newly created group is stored with dc in lowercase in ldap.
> I dont know if its specific for Tivoli directory server, but my wish is to have DS working with case of DN exactly like it's stored in ldap ;)
